Abstract

Currently the excessive demand for solid resources is affecting ecosystems and generating negative impacts on the environment, one of these reasons is the generation of solid waste, therefore there is a need to provide methods, techniques, and procedures to reduce these impacts. The objective of this work was to analyze the environmental impact of a solid waste plant in the Francisco Morales Bermúdez market. For them, a design of a solid waste plant was developed to reduce the negative impacts that operations such as solid waste management and wastewater discharge generate, which is why we use the Conesa matrix to identify the impacts before and after the application of the design. Finally, it was concluded that the application of the solid waste plant design presents positive impacts on the environment, that is, the physical factor in addition to presenting positive impacts on the occupational health of the personnel of the Francisco Morales Bermúdez market.
